Advanced Simulink Tools and Libraries in Simscape

Simulink’s graphical environment is not just a modeling tool; it’s a comprehensive system that combines electrical, mechanical, and hydraulic domains, enabling engineers to simulate real-world systems.

Templates and Advanced Libraries in Simulink 

Simulink provides pre-built templates for specific applications, saving time and effort: 

  • Hydraulic Templates: For modeling systems with fluid dynamics. 
  • Electrical Templates: For circuits and power systems. 
  • Mechanical Templates: For designing mechanical systems like suspensions. 

These templates come pre-configured with inputs, outputs, and foundational blocks, enabling you to jump-start your projects. For example, selecting a Hydraulic Simscape Model opens a workspace with essential components like input sources, conversion blocks, and display systems. 


Exploring the Library Browser 

The Library Browser is a treasure trove of resources, organized into categories like: 

  • Simscape Components: For modeling physical systems. 
  • Control Systems: For implementing feedback and control logic. 
  • Electromechanical Systems: Including motors, actuators, and solenoids. 
  • Dashboard Tools: For creating user-friendly interfaces with knobs, gauges, and switches. 

For example, to model a DC motor, navigate to the Simscape Electrical Library, drag the motor block into your workspace, and configure its parameters like voltage, torque, and efficiency. Similarly, you can use Spring and Damper Blocks from the mechanical library to model suspension systems. 


Building and Simulating a Complex Model 

Let’s consider an example of a solenoid system: 

  • Add a Solenoid Block from the Simscape library. 
  • Configure its parameters, including stiffness, damping, and magnetic force. 
  • Connect the solenoid to a DC power supply and visualize its behavior using a Scope Block. 

This setup demonstrates how Simulink integrates electrical and mechanical domains seamlessly. The solenoid’s mechanical movement depends on the electrical input, showcasing Simulink’s ability to handle multi-domain modeling. 


Real-World Applications 

Simulink is widely used in industries like automotive, aerospace, and energy. Applications include: 

  • Motor Control Systems: Designing and optimizing motor drives. 
  • Pump Systems: Simulating flow rates and energy efficiency. 
  • Suspension Models: Testing vehicle dynamics under various conditions. 

By leveraging Simulink’s advanced features, engineers can design systems that are efficient, cost-effective, and ready for real-world challenges.
